网络安全是每个用户和系统管理员都应该关注并且加以保护的重要问题。在Linux操作系统中,有许多网络安全技巧和工具可以帮助我们确保系统和数据的安全。本文将向您介绍一些Linux下的网络安全技巧,以帮助您提升系统的安全性。
1. 使用防火墙
防火墙是保护网络安全的第一道防线,可以帮助我们监控和控制网络流量。Linux中有许多流行的防火墙解决方案,如iptables和ufw。配置和管理防火墙可以帮助我们过滤不安全的网络连接并且限制进入和离开我们系统的流量。
2. 更新软件包和操作系统
定期更新软件包和操作系统是确保系统安全的重要措施。更新包括修复漏洞和安全漏洞的补丁,可以防止黑客通过已知的漏洞侵入系统。
3. 使用强密码
使用强密码是保护您的系统免受密码破解的重要方法。强密码应包含大写和小写字母、数字和特殊字符,并且长度应足够长。此外,定期更改密码也是一种好的安全实践。
4. 使用密钥身份验证
使用密钥身份验证可以增强系统的安全性,相较于传统的密码身份验证更可靠。密钥身份验证使用密钥对来验证用户的身份,这些密钥对由公钥和私钥组成。公钥可以存储在服务器上,而私钥必须严格保密。
5. 禁用不必要的服务
Linux操作系统默认安装了一些不必要的服务和组件,这些可能增加系统的攻击面。为了提高系统的安全性,我们应该禁用那些不需要的服务,并且只开启我们需要的服务。
6. 监控网络流量
监控网络流量可以帮助我们检测和防止潜在的入侵和攻击。有许多网络监控工具可以使用,如Wireshark和tcpdump。通过监视网络流量,我们可以识别异常活动并及时采取措施。
7. 使用加密协议
在网络通信中使用加密协议可以保护我们的数据免受恶意劫持和窃取。常见的加密协议包括SSL和TLS。确保我们的网络连接使用加密协议可以防止黑客获取敏感信息。
8. 定期备份数据
定期备份数据是防止数据丢失的关键措施,特别是在存在网络攻击和恶意软件的风险下。通过定期备份,即使我们的系统遭受攻击,我们也可以轻松恢复数据。
9. 使用安全的远程访问方式
使用SSH(安全外壳协议)来进行远程访问是一种安全的方式。SSH提供了加密的通信渠道,允许我们在远程操作系统和文件时保护数据免受第三方的窃听和篡改。
10. 审计系统日志
定期审计系统日志是发现潜在入侵和异常活动的一种方法。记录并分析系统日志可以帮助我们识别安全事件,并采取适当的措施。
总结: 在Linux下,有许多网络安全技巧和工具可以保护我们的系统和数据。通过使用防火墙、更新软件包和操作系统、使用强密码和密钥身份验证、禁用不必要的服务、监控网络流量、使用加密协议、定期备份数据、使用安全的远程访问方式和审计系统日志,我们可以大大增强系统的安全性。请务必采取这些措施,保护您的系统免受网络攻击和数据泄露的风险。
本文来自极简博客,作者:幻想之翼,转载请注明原文链接:Linux下的网络安全技巧